Dual, Multiphase Synchronous DC/DC Controller with Differential Remote Sense Features n Dual, 180° Phased Controllers Reduce Required Input Capacitance and Power Supply Induced Noise n High Efficiency: Up to 95% n RSENSE or DCR Current Sensing n Programmable DCR Temperature pensation n ±0.75% 0.6V Output Voltage Accuracy n Phase-Lockable Fixed Frequency 250k Hz to 770k Hz n True Remote Sensing Differential Amplifier n Dual N-Channel MOSFET Synchronous Drive n Wide VIN Range: 4.5V to 38V n VOUT Range: 0.6V to 12.5V without Differential Amplifier n VOUT Range: 0.6V to 3.3V with Differential Amplifier n Clock Input and Output for Up to 12-Phase Operation n Adjustable Soft-Start or VOUT Tracking n Foldback Output Current Limiting n Output Overvoltage Protection n 40-Pin (6mm × 6mm) QFN and 38-Lead FE Packages Applications n puter Systems n Tele Systems n Industrial and Medical Instruments n DC Power Distribution Systems Description The LTC®3855 is a dual Poly Phase® current mode synchronous step-down switching regulator controller that drives all N-channel power MOSFET stages. It includes a high speed differential remote sense amplifier. The maximum current sense voltage is programmable for either 30m V, 50m V or 75m V, allowing the use of either the inductor DCR or a discrete sense resistor as the sensing element. The LTC3855 Features a precision 0.6V reference and can produce output voltages up to 12.5V. A wide 4.5V to 38V input supply range enpasses most intermediate bus voltages and battery chemistries. Power loss and supply noise are minimized by operating the two controller output stages out of phase. Burst Mode® operation, continuous or pulse-skipping modes are supported. The LTC3855 can be configured for up to 12-phase operation, has DCR temperature pensation, two power good signals and two current limit set pins. The LTC3855 is available in low profile 40-pin 6mm × 6mm QFN and 38-lead exposed pad FE packages. L, LT, LTC, LTM, Linear...
